How EXKOP® Works
Pipelines and vessels in bulk-processing systems often connect through common lines. If a dust explosion occurs in one area, pressure waves and flame fronts spread quickly through these links. That can cause secondary explosions in other equipment.
EXKOP® isolates these components using:
- A self‑monitoring controller, either EXKOP® Express or EXKOP® II TriCon.
- One or more quench valves (QV II or QV III).
In an explosion event, the controller receives a trigger signal. It may come from a pressure switch, spark detector, or explosion vent.
The system responds by closing quench valves within milliseconds. This stops flame propagation in both directions and secures connected equipment.
Key System Components
EXKOP® Controller
Handles trigger signals, activates valves, and logs data. Offers remote monitoring, PLC integration, and is ATEX‑certified.
Quench Valves (QV II / QV III)
Close rapidly under compressed air to isolate pipelines. Fail‑safe design ensures closure even during air or power loss.
Valve Sizes
QV II covers pipe diameters DN 80–250; QV III fits DN 300–600.
EXKOP® Express vs. TriCon
The Express model integrates multiple isolation devices with a touch panel and remote access. The TriCon supports up to 3 valves in a compact design.

Typical Applications
EXKOP® protects equipment across many processes, including:
- Aspiration and pneumatic transport lines
- Mills, filters, silos, and mixers
- Spray dryers and elevators
- Animal‑feed production, breweries, chemical plants, recycling facilities, and wood processing
Combining EXKOP® with explosion vents, flameless vents, or active isolation devices maximizes protection across complex systems.
Technical Overview
- Nominal pressure rated to at least 10 bar
- Dust types handled safely up to KST 300 bar·m/s
- Materials: rugged aluminium or steel housing with mounted flanges
- Operating range: +5 °C to +60 °C (temperature ranges vary by model)
- Certifications: ATEX, IECEx, EN 15089 compliant
Installation, Operation, and Maintenance
Valve sizes range from DN 80 to DN 600. They fit standard EN 1092‑1 PN 10 flanges. Mounting aligns to ensure tight fit. Controllers connect easily to process control systems via relay outputs.
After activation, routine resets only take seconds. Remote diagnostics are available via modem or Ethernet. Interactive AR models and touch panels support maintenance and troubleshooting.
